WTA number one-ranked Caroline Wozniacki has hired Ricardo Sanchez as her new coach. Sanchez will replace her father, Piotr Wozniacki, who supposedly "wanted to get a little bit of time off the court."

Sanchez’s first goal with Wozniacki will be to have her win the Australian Open in January. Wozniacki is yet to win a Grand Slam tournament. Wozniacki suggested that it was her father’s recommendation to hire Sanchez. The elder Wozniacki has been criticized for having his daughter play in too many tournaments throughout the year.
